I have tried everything that I know and am looking for help.

When I can use mplayer to play a stream from the card, but the tuner only
seems to lock on channel 5 and 6. And the quaility of that tunning is very
poor. Channel 5 audio is clear, but video is mostly black and white. Channel
6 the video is mostly color, but the sound has static on it.

This seems like the same issue as
http://ubuntuforums.org/showthread.php?t=298743 but there does not apear to
have been any resolution.

Please any help would be greatly welcomed.

I am running a Fresh Gentoo install with kernel 2.6.19-r5 (Build from
gentoo-sources)
I have emerged the ivtv driver form portage.
I have tried both the firmware that is recommended and the recent version
attached to the .10 series. release canditate.
I did try to install ivtv version 0.10.0r1, but had issues getting the test
directory to comiple. I was able to comment that out and get the 0.10.0r1 to
install, but had the same issues. I even tried the svn and that had the same
results.


Thank you,
Drew


ivtv:  ==================== START INIT IVTV ====================
ivtv:  version 0.9.1 (tagged release) loading
ivtv:  Linux version: 2.6.19-gentoo-r5 SMP mod_unload PENTIUM4 REGPARM
ivtv:  In case of problems please include the debug info between
ivtv:  the START INIT IVTV and END INIT IVTV lines, along with
ivtv:  any module options, when mailing the ivtv-users mailinglist.
ivtv0: Autodetected Hauppauge card (cx23416 based)
ACPI: PCI Interrupt 0000:04:08.0[A] -> GSI 16 (level, low) -> IRQ 16
ivtv0: loaded v4l-cx2341x-enc.fw firmware (262144 bytes)
tveeprom 1-0050: Hauppauge model 23552, rev D492, serial# 8174338
tveeprom 1-0050: tuner model is Philips FQ1236A MK4 (idx 92, type 57)
tveeprom 1-0050: TV standards NTSC(M) (eeprom 0x08)
tveeprom 1-0050: second tuner model is Philips TEA5768HL FM Radio (idx 101,
type 62)
tveeprom 1-0050: audio processor is CX25843 (idx 37)
tveeprom 1-0050: decoder processor is CX25843 (idx 30)
tveeprom 1-0050: has radio, has no IR remote
ivtv0: Autodetected WinTV PVR 500 (unit #1)
tuner 0-0061: chip found @ 0xc2 (cx88[0])
tuner 0-0061: type set to 68 (Philips TUV1236D ATSC/NTSC dual in)
tuner 0-0061: type set to 68 (Philips TUV1236D ATSC/NTSC dual in)
tuner 1-0043: chip found @ 0x86 (ivtv i2c driver #0)
tda9887 1-0043: tda988[5/6/7] found @ 0x43 (tuner)
tuner 1-0060: TEA5767 detected.
tuner 1-0060: chip found @ 0xc0 (ivtv i2c driver #0)
tuner 1-0060: type set to 62 (Philips TEA5767HN FM Radio)
tuner 1-0061: chip found @ 0xc2 (ivtv i2c driver #0)
cx25840 1-0044: cx25843-23 found @ 0x88 (ivtv i2c driver #0)
cx25840 1-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
wm8775 1-001b: chip found @ 0x36 (ivtv i2c driver #0)
ivtv0: Encoder revision: 0x02060039
ivtv0 warning: Encoder Firmware can be buggy, use version 0x02040011,
0x02040024 or 0x02050032.
ivtv0: Registered device video0 for encoder MPEG
ivtv0: Registered device video32 for encoder YUV
ivtv0: Registered device vbi0 for encoder VBI
ivtv0: Registered device video24 for encoder PCM audio
ivtv0: Registered device radio0 for encoder radio
tuner 1-0061: type set to 57 (Philips FQ1236A MK4)
ivtv0: Initialized WinTV PVR 500 (unit #1), card #0
ivtv:  ======================  NEXT CARD  ======================
ivtv1: Autodetected Hauppauge card (cx23416 based)
ACPI: PCI Interrupt 0000:04:09.0[A] -> GSI 17 (level, low) -> IRQ 21
ivtv1: loaded v4l-cx2341x-enc.fw firmware (262144 bytes)
tuner 2-0043: chip found @ 0x86 (ivtv i2c driver #1)
tda9887 2-0043: tda988[5/6/7] found @ 0x43 (tuner)
tuner 2-0061: chip found @ 0xc2 (ivtv i2c driver #1)
cx25840 2-0044: cx25843-23 found @ 0x88 (ivtv i2c driver #1)
cx25840 2-0044: loaded v4l-cx25840.fw firmware (16382 bytes)
wm8775 2-001b: chip found @ 0x36 (ivtv i2c driver #1)
tveeprom 2-0050: Hauppauge model 23552, rev D492, serial# 8174338
tveeprom 2-0050: tuner model is Philips FQ1236A MK4 (idx 92, type 57)
tveeprom 2-0050: TV standards NTSC(M) (eeprom 0x08)
tveeprom 2-0050: second tuner model is Philips TEA5768HL FM Radio (idx 101,
type 62)
tveeprom 2-0050: audio processor is CX25843 (idx 37)
tveeprom 2-0050: decoder processor is CX25843 (idx 30)
tveeprom 2-0050: has radio, has no IR remote
ivtv1: Correcting tveeprom data: no radio present on second unit
ivtv1: Autodetected WinTV PVR 500 (unit #2)
ivtv1: Encoder revision: 0x02060039
ivtv1 warning: Encoder Firmware can be buggy, use version 0x02040011,
0x02040024 or 0x02050032.
ivtv1: Registered device video1 for encoder MPEG
ivtv1: Registered device video33 for encoder YUV
ivtv1: Registered device vbi1 for encoder VBI
ivtv1: Registered device video25 for encoder PCM audio
tuner 2-0061: type set to 57 (Philips FQ1236A MK4)
ivtv1: Initialized WinTV PVR 500 (unit #2), card #1
ivtv:  ====================  END INIT IVTV  ====================



Compile problem with SVN
cc   cx25840ctl.o cx25840-registers.o cmdline.o   -o cx25840ctl
make[2]: Leaving directory
`/usr/local/src/ivtv/ivtv-svn/trunk/utils/cx25840ctl'
make[1]: Leaving directory `/usr/local/src/ivtv/ivtv-svn/trunk/utils'
make -C test all
make[1]: Entering directory `/usr/local/src/ivtv/ivtv-svn/trunk/test'
cc -I../driver -I../utils -D_GNU_SOURCE -O2 -Wall  -lm  vbi.c   -o vbi
vbi.c:138: warning: 'struct v4l2_sliced_vbi_data' declared inside parameter
list
vbi.c:138: warning: its scope is only this definition or declaration, which
is probably not what you want
vbi.c: In function 'decode_wss':
vbi.c:143: error: dereferencing pointer to incomplete type
vbi.c:143: error: dereferencing pointer to incomplete type
vbi.c: At top level:
vbi.c:176: warning: 'struct v4l2_sliced_vbi_data' declared inside parameter
list
vbi.c: In function 'decode_xds':
vbi.c:181: error: dereferencing pointer to incomplete type
vbi.c:181: error: dereferencing pointer to incomplete type
vbi.c:184: error: dereferencing pointer to incomplete type
vbi.c:184: error: dereferencing pointer to incomplete type
vbi.c: At top level:
vbi.c:192: warning: 'struct v4l2_sliced_vbi_data' declared inside parameter
list
vbi.c: In function 'decode_cc':
vbi.c:195: error: dereferencing pointer to incomplete type
vbi.c:201: error: dereferencing pointer to incomplete type
vbi.c:203: error: dereferencing pointer to incomplete type
vbi.c:204: warning: passing argument 1 of 'decode_xds' from incompatible
pointer type
vbi.c:207: warning: passing argument 1 of 'decode_xds' from incompatible
pointer type
vbi.c:212: error: dereferencing pointer to incomplete type
vbi.c:213: error: dereferencing pointer to incomplete type
vbi.c:214: error: dereferencing pointer to incomplete type
vbi.c:215: error: dereferencing pointer to incomplete type
vbi.c:216: error: dereferencing pointer to incomplete type
vbi.c:217: error: dereferencing pointer to incomplete type
vbi.c:218: error: dereferencing pointer to incomplete type
vbi.c:218: error: dereferencing pointer to incomplete type
vbi.c:218: error: dereferencing pointer to incomplete type
vbi.c:220: error: dereferencing pointer to incomplete type
vbi.c:221: error: dereferencing pointer to incomplete type
vbi.c:221: error: dereferencing pointer to incomplete type
vbi.c:225: error: dereferencing pointer to incomplete type
vbi.c:226: error: dereferencing pointer to incomplete type
vbi.c:226: error: dereferencing pointer to incomplete type
vbi.c:233: error: dereferencing pointer to incomplete type
vbi.c:233: error: dereferencing pointer to incomplete type
vbi.c:241: error: dereferencing pointer to incomplete type
vbi.c:241: error: dereferencing pointer to incomplete type
vbi.c: At top level:
vbi.c:410: warning: 'struct v4l2_sliced_vbi_data' declared inside parameter
list
vbi.c: In function 'decode_vps':
vbi.c:417: error: dereferencing pointer to incomplete type
vbi.c: At top level:
vbi.c:453: warning: 'struct v4l2_sliced_vbi_data' declared inside parameter
list
vbi.c: In function 'teletext':
vbi.c:455: error: dereferencing pointer to incomplete type
vbi.c:455: error: dereferencing pointer to incomplete type
vbi.c:465: error: dereferencing pointer to incomplete type
vbi.c:465: error: dereferencing pointer to incomplete type
vbi.c:478: error: dereferencing pointer to incomplete type
vbi.c:480: error: dereferencing pointer to incomplete type
vbi.c:482: error: dereferencing pointer to incomplete type
vbi.c:492: error: dereferencing pointer to incomplete type
vbi.c: At top level:
vbi.c:499: warning: 'struct v4l2_sliced_vbi_data' declared inside parameter
list
vbi.c: In function 'process':
vbi.c:501: error: dereferencing pointer to incomplete type
vbi.c:505: error: dereferencing pointer to incomplete type
vbi.c:506: error: 'V4L2_SLICED_TELETEXT_B' undeclared (first use in this
function)
vbi.c:506: error: (Each undeclared identifier is reported only once
vbi.c:506: error: for each function it appears in.)
vbi.c:508: warning: passing argument 1 of 'teletext' from incompatible
pointer type
vbi.c:510: error: 'V4L2_SLICED_VPS' undeclared (first use in this function)
vbi.c:511: error: dereferencing pointer to incomplete type
vbi.c:511: error: dereferencing pointer to incomplete type
vbi.c:514: warning: passing argument 1 of 'decode_vps' from incompatible
pointer type
vbi.c:516: error: 'V4L2_SLICED_WSS_625' undeclared (first use in this
function)
vbi.c:517: error: dereferencing pointer to incomplete type
vbi.c:517: error: dereferencing pointer to incomplete type
vbi.c:520: warning: passing argument 1 of 'decode_wss' from incompatible
pointer type
vbi.c:522: error: 'V4L2_SLICED_CAPTION_525' undeclared (first use in this
function)
vbi.c:523: error: dereferencing pointer to incomplete type
vbi.c:525: warning: passing argument 1 of 'decode_cc' from incompatible
pointer type
vbi.c: In function 'cc_readback':
vbi.c:540: error: storage size of 'data' isn't known
vbi.c:540: warning: unused variable 'data'
vbi.c: In function 'main':
vbi.c:650: error: 'V4L2_BUF_TYPE_SLICED_VBI_CAPTURE' undeclared (first use
in this function)
vbi.c:651: error: 'union <anonymous>' has no member named 'sliced'
vbi.c:651: error: 'V4L2_SLICED_VBI_525' undeclared (first use in this
function)
vbi.c:651: error: 'V4L2_SLICED_VBI_625' undeclared (first use in this
function)
vbi.c:652: error: 'union <anonymous>' has no member named 'sliced'
vbi.c:653: error: 'union <anonymous>' has no member named 'sliced'
vbi.c:660: error: 'union <anonymous>' has no member named 'sliced'
vbi.c:660: error: 'union <anonymous>' has no member named 'sliced'
vbi.c:670: error: 'union <anonymous>' has no member named 'sliced'
vbi.c:672: error: 'union <anonymous>' has no member named 'sliced'
vbi.c:678: error: invalid application of 'sizeof' to incomplete type 'struct
v4l2_sliced_vbi_data'
vbi.c:678: warning: division by zero
vbi.c:679: error: invalid use of undefined type 'struct
v4l2_sliced_vbi_data'
vbi.c:679: error: dereferencing pointer to incomplete type
make[1]: *** [vbi] Error 1
make[1]: Leaving directory `/usr/local/src/ivtv/ivtv-svn/trunk/test'
make: *** [all] Error 2
_______________________________________________
ivtv-devel mailing list
[email protected]
http://ivtvdriver.org/mailman/listinfo/ivtv-devel

Reply via email to